Exploring Language and Franchises in Gaming Culture Today

Close-up of gaming console with vibrant racing game display.


Understanding Gaming Grammar: What's in a Word?

In this month's Nintendo Life Mailbox, one passionate gamer raised an intriguing question about language that's particularly relevant for the gaming community: the use of "release" as an intransitive verb. As we all know, gaming culture has its own lexicon, and how we articulate it can shape the community’s identity. The discussion brought forth by Maxz highlights a growing trend among gamers who are increasingly using phrases like "the game releases next month.” While traditional grammar rules suggest that 'release' requires a direct object, the evolution of language in gaming contexts begs the question: Are we witnessing a shift in language norms akin to how gaming has transformed over the years?

As a culture steeped in creativity and innovation, gaming offers a lens through which we can observe the fluidity of language. Ed, another contributor noted in the Mailbox, shared that he now uses this phrasing himself, indicating that acceptance often follows usage. This resonance within a community shouldn't be overlooked—it rather reflects a powerful intersection of language and culture.

Potential Animated Franchises: Reviving Classics

Transitioning from grammar to creative aspirations, Kazman2007 brought up the idea of utilizing animations to revitalize dormant Nintendo franchises. Imagining beloved games like F-Zero receiving cinematic adaptations not only taps into nostalgia but also allows fans to engage with the franchise without the heavy investment of a full-scale game production. While this presents a fantastic opportunity for creativity, it's also met with skepticism; would the engagement from animated shorts be sufficient to justify this artistic choice? For gamers, these discussions about potential franchise revivals reflect a yearning for connection to the past while remaining hopeful for the future.

Engagement can Fuel Future Developments

The dialogue around both language use and franchise revival underscores the importance of community engagement within gaming. Players care deeply about how their favorite mediums are represented and want to see innovation that resonates with them. Whether it’s rethinking grammar to adapt to contemporary usage or creating animated shorts to gauge interest in storied franchises, the exchange between creators and fans illustrates how the gaming landscape continues to evolve.

In a world where social media amplifies these conversations, it's crucial for developers to listen. Animations and optimized communication could bridge the gap between fan expectations and production realities, ensuring the gaming world continues to thrive amidst shifting consumer preferences.
